I am using VB.NET 2003, SQL 2000, and SqlDataReader.
As I read data from tblA, I want to populate tblB. I use SQLDataReader for
both tables. I do not use thread.
When I ExecuteReader on tblB, I get the error "There is already an open
DataReader associated with this Connection which must be closed first."
How can I fix this error ?
For each DataReader, do I want to open and close the connection (in this
case adoCon) to avoid this error ?
Thank you.

m_cmdSQL = New SqlClient.SqlCommand
With m_cmdSQL
.Connection = adoCon
.CommandText = "SELECT * FROM tblA"
End With
m_drSQL = m_cmdSQL.ExecuteReader()
Do While m_drSQL.Read
sSQL = "insert into tblB (Account,name,Company)"
sSQL = sSQL & (" VALUES ('" & m_drSQL.Item("Account") & "'")
sSQL = sSQL & (" ,'" & m_drSQL.Item("Name") & "'")
sSQL = sSQL & (" ,'" & m_drSQL.Item("company") & "')")
m_cmdSQL2 = New SqlClient.SqlCommand
With m_cmdSQL2
.Connection = adoCon
.CommandText = sSQL
End With
m_drSQL2 = m_cmdSQL2.ExecuteReader() ---> ERROR: There is already
an open DataReader associated with this Connection which must be closed
first.
rs.CloseRS()
rs = Nothing
Loop

It makes no sense to call ExecuteReader on an INSERT statement.
ExecuteReader is designed to retrieve data into a DataReader. To
execute your INSERT statement, call ExecuteNonQuery.

In general, you cannot have two open queries to the same SQL Server database
from your application. Even if you use a different connection, ADO.NET is
probably doing connection pooling/sharing. If you absolutely must have both
queries open at once (or you need to have one query open while you issue
NonQuery updates to the same database), there are two alternatives.

1) Load the first query into a DataTable or DataSet object instead of using
a DataReader. This might not be a good idea of you have massive amounts of
data coming back from the query.

2) Enable "MARS" in your SQL Server connect. (I think MARS stands for "Multiple
Active Result Sets.") MARS is new in the 2005 version of SQL Server, and
requires version 2.0 of the .NET Framework. Other databases, such as Oracle,
support MARS-like features, although under a different name. You can find
information about MARS in the Visual Studio documentation. Basically, you
add an extra parameter to your connection string to enable it.

Am I the only one who is thinking 'what the hell is he doing this for?'?

A much more efficient approach would be to get the Sql Server to do the
work.

As far as I can see it is as simple as:

Dim _con As New SqlConnection(<connection string>)

Dim _com As New SqlCommand("insert into tblB(Account,name,Company) select
Account,Name,company from tblA", _con

_con.Open()

_com.ExecuteNonQuery()

_con.Close()

But aside from that here is your code with the problem areas annotated:

' Turn both Option Strict and Option Explicit on

m_cmdSQL = New SqlCommand()
' variable used without being explicitly defined
'should be
Dim m_cmdSQL As New SqlCommand()

With m_cmdSQL
.Connection = adoCon
' adoCon is assumed to be a properly constructed SqlConnection object
.CommandText = "SELECT * FROM tblA"
End With

m_drSQL = m_cmdSQL.ExecuteReader()
' variable used without being explicitly defined
'should be
Dim m_drSQL As SqlDataReader = m_cmdSQL.ExecuteReader()

DBCon = New SqlConnection()
' variable used without being explicitly defined
'should be
Dim DBCon As New SqlConnection()

With DBCon
.ConnectionString = DB_Path
.Open()
End With

' the above can be better written as
Dim DBCon As New SqlConnection(adoCon.ConnectionString)
DBCon.Open()
' this way ensures that the connection string used for DBCon is the same as
the connectionstring used adoCon

' moved to here because the SqlCommand object need to be instantiated only
once
Dim m_cmdSQL2 As New SqlCommand("insert into tblB (Account,name,Company)
values(@account,@name,@company)", DBCon
' but this way some parameters are required and these need their values
populated on each iteration
m_cmdSQL2.Parameters.Add("@account")
m_cmdSQL2.Parameters.Add("@name")
m_cmdSQL2.Parameters.Add("@company")

' although Do While/Loop is effectively the same as While/End While, I
consider the While/End While to be more intuitive and easier to read
While m_drSQL.Read()
' supply the values for the parameters from the incoming values
m_cmdSQL2.Parameters("@account").Value = m_drSQL("Account")
m_cmdSQL2.Parameters("@name").Value = m_drSQL("Name")
m_cmdSQL2.Parameters("@company").Value = m_drSQL("company")
' execute the insert statement
m_cmdSQL2.ExecuteNonQuery()
End While

' close the connection that was opened
DBCon.Close()

' close the SqlDataReader object
drSQL.Close()

While some providers (not ADO.NET) do support multiple operations on a
single connection (like Oracle), they do so because (for the most part)
their connections are so complex. SQL Server (and others have far simpler
(and cheaper) connection classes that can only support a single operation at
a time. This means it often makes sense for applications to open two or more
connections to the server to handle independent operations.

Ok, that said, whenever I see someone trying to open more than one
connection I start to look more closely at the problem they're trying to
solve. In many (too many) cases, the operation should have been done on the
server--not on the client or with bulk copy.

That's why I asked, is this trip really necessary...
